Howdy, just thought I'd pass along a problem with the carefree awning on my TT. Went to put it out and BLAM! it free fell to the open position. long story short.... small steel gear in the motor assembly of the leading arm BROKE. It is at the dealer at the present time, still under warrenty. But it could have been bad had someone been standing in the area. Be careful
